Sorry that it has taken me so long to get this update posted everyone! Over the weekend of May 5th I raced a South Central Loretta Lynn area qualifier in Lakewood, CO. Overall the weekend went really well and I qualified in all 4 of my classes for the Regional race in Texas the first weekend in June. The crash I had at the Sterling race took more of a toll on my body than we originally thought! I was unable to train or ride the week prior to this race due to soreness and my stomach area not feeling well. For the Lakewood race every moto I was having sharp stomach pains and I was unable to finish my races really strong like I am used to! Luckily my starts were really good this weekend so I was able to hold on for qualifying positions. The Monday after the race I went to the Drs. I found out that I had some swollen and bruised internal organs and the Dr. suggested rest and lots of it! My next race will be the amateur days race at the pro national in Texas the last weekend in May! Starting next week I will work my way back to my training and riding schedule to be ready for our Texas trip. The amateur day race is on the same track as our Loretta Lynn Regional qualifier the following weekend. I will post updates and photos as much as I can while were in Texas.
